Drosha drosha, ribonuclease type III [ Mus musculus (house mouse) ]

Symbol: Drosha
Full name: drosha, ribonuclease type III
Gene type: protein coding
RefSeq status: VALIDATED
Organism: Mus musculus
Also known as: 1110013A17Rik; Etohi2; Rn3; Rnasen
Summary: Enables endoribonuclease activity and primary miRNA binding activity. Involved in positive regulation of gene expression. Acts upstream of or within several processes, including ncRNA metabolic process; regulation of miRNA metabolic process; and regulation of regulatory T cell differentiation. Located in postsynaptic density. Is expressed in several structures, including central nervous system; early embryo; genitourinary system; hemolymphoid system gland; and tooth. Orthologous to human DROSHA (drosha ribonuclease III). [provided by Alliance of Genome Resources, Apr 2022]
Expression: Ubiquitous expression in CNS E11.5 (RPKM 18.2), CNS E14 (RPKM 14.7) and 27 other tissues
Orthologs: human
Gene size: 110485bp
Exon count: 36
